AVA’s ArtReach program invites you to join artists LIVE each week. Get a glimpse into the creative minds of experienced artists as they take you through the art-making process – from beginning with a blank canvas or raw materials, through decisions about themes, materials, media, colors, techniques, and other aspects of their practice. Learn More »Derek Bell: Perfect Poultry Portraits
Derek Bell is a VT-based painter. He received his BFA in Painting in 2008 from Rhode Island School of Design and spent three of his years there as a Teaching Assistant. As a painter, Derek prefers landscape, portraiture and animals, as well as an occasional still life. Since graduating from RISD, Derek works primarily in oils, watercolor, gouache and more recently egg tempera. The artist grew up on a horse farm in Vermont, and from an early age learned to paint and draw in a way he describes as “an almost monastic training in art.”
